Zahara is an infrastructure platform designed as an AI Agent Control Plane. It provides tools intended to help AI agents move from demo stages into production by focusing on reliability and accountability.

The platform is designed for software companies and developers who operate numerous agents or manage workers using multiple personal agents. It provides a centralized layer for governing agent behavior and billing.

Capabilities include agent identification, budget tracking via wallets, and governance tools such as kill-switches and rate limits. It also supports LLM-agnostic routing, which allows users to select models based on the specific task to avoid vendor lock-in.

Key Features

Agent Governance

Includes RBAC, policies, audit trails, rate limits, and kill-switches to manage agent behavior.

Agent IDs and Wallets

Supports attribution, spend tracking, and payouts for AI agents.

LLM-Agnostic Routing

Designed to route tasks to different models based on the task with available fallbacks.

Observability Suite

Provides traces, evaluations, replay capabilities, and dashboards to monitor agent performance.

Monetization Hooks

Includes metering, billing APIs, and marketplace payouts for commercializing agents.

Build Tools

Offers a visual flow builder, a PRO IDE with CI/CD, and natural-language scaffolding.

MCP Protocol Integrations

Supports an open standard to connect agents with a variety of tools.
